About Us

Shadforth are one of Queensland’s largest family-owned civil construction companies originating on the Sunshine Coast over 50 years ago. We have a strong presence across Queensland and Northern New South Wales where we have developed an outstanding reputation working across many sectors including residential and commercial subdivisions and major civil infrastructure, including roads and bridges.
